Condensation on the internal surface

Double glazing can cause condensation on its interior surface especially in the Autumn. It is a natural process that occurs when warmer air condenses on colder exterior surfaces.

The ideal solution is to use a dehumidifier or increase circulation, in order to remove moisture. But if the moisture is allowed to remain on the surface, it may cause the frame to decay and cause black mould. If your window is older the moisture will be trapped on the interior and exterior surfaces.

The condensation can also be on the frame or sill, which could cause damp and cause damage. Keep your windows well ventilated to avoid this. When cooking or bathing, it's recommended to clean the cold surfaces.


Double-glazed units may have crystalline desiccant in their spacer bars, which reduce humidity levels. If the seal fails, moisture will continue to get into the room.

On the other hand, the condensation on the inside of the glass is a sign of the seal is not properly sealed. To determine if there is a problem check the sealant as well as the cill. You can also use a squeezer to get rid of the moisture from the outside.

Insufficient air circulation or poor sealing could cause internal condensation. This can occur with windows that are single-glazed, but more often when double-glazed units are used.

Double-glazed windows and an insulated walls are essential to have an energy-efficient home. They can reduce the amount of water that condenses on the internal surfaces of windows. These products are also resistant to heat transfer across air spaces.

Another alternative is to make use of an epoxy resin repair product. The life span of your window could be extended by using an repair system made of resin. A specially-formulated polyester resin can be used to repair the rusty or damaged sash.

A window frame that is badly corroded might need to be replaced. Angle brackets made of metal are the least intrusive method to reinforce it. You can also fit new timber to the frame. Make sure that the new wood is in line with the grain orientation of the original profile.

When making repairs using splices make sure that the spliced joints are formed to give maximum strength. The replacements should be made using the same type of wood as the original.

Using a household screwdriver look for any damage to corners or along edges of the frame. A minor distortion can be fixed by gently taking the frame back into alignment.
